TechSee Welcomes Lawrence Askowitz to Its Advisory Board
TechSee, a pioneering firm specializing in Visual Agentic AI technology, has announced the addition of Lawrence Askowitz, Managing Director at The Bank Street Group, to its Telecom Advisory Board. This strategic move is designed to enhance the company's offerings for the communication and electronics industries, particularly by optimizing customer experiences and reducing churn.
Lawrence Askowitz: A Telecom Veteran
With over 30 years in the telecom sector, Askowitz has an impressive track record, having worked with both major industry leaders and emerging companies across the United States. He has played pivotal roles in transactions totaling over $200 billion, demonstrating his expertise in navigating the complex landscape of telecommunications. His involvement in supporting fiber broadband, wireless providers, and system integrators has made him a distinguished figure in the field.

Tackling Frustrations in Connectivity
The U.S. telecommunications landscape has witnessed substantial investments aimed at modernizing broadband infrastructures. However, many customers continue to face challenges stemming from poor connectivity in their homes and workplaces. Askowitz highlighted that these frustrations often lead to unnecessary service calls and can significantly contribute to customer churn, which in turn compounds operational costs for service providers.
TechSee aims to alleviate these issues with its cutting-edge solutions, which enhance customer interactions through visual intelligence and automated processes. By fostering clearer communication and swift resolutions, providers can mitigate contact center expenses and enhance overall satisfaction.
